2026计算机数据结构高频考点算法归纳真题及答案(算法整理).docVIP

  • 2
  • 0
  • 约3.13千字
  • 约 12页
  • 2026-05-12 发布于安徽
  • 举报

2026计算机数据结构高频考点算法归纳真题及答案(算法整理).doc

2026计算机数据结构高频考点算法归纳真题及答案(算法整理)

一、单项选择题(共20题,每题2分,共40分)。每小题只有一个正确答案,请将正确答案的序号填在答题栏内)。

1.在线性表中,插入一个新元素的时间复杂度是()。

A.O(1)

B.O(n)

C.O(logn)

D.O(n^2)

2.下列数据结构中,最适合进行快速插入和删除操作的是()。

A.链表

B.数组

C.栈

D.队列

3.在二叉搜索树中,查找一个元素的时间复杂度最坏情况下是()。

A.O(1)

B.O(logn)

C.O(n)

D.O(n^2)

4.下列关于图的遍历算法中,哪个算法不能保证访问到图中的所有顶点()。

A.深度优先搜索

B.广度优先搜索

C.Dijkstra算法

D.A算法

5.在快速排序算法中,平均情况下的时间复杂度是()。

A.O(1)

B.O(logn)

C.O(n)

D.O(nlogn)

6.下列数据结构中,哪个是先进先出(FIFO)的数据结构()。

A.栈

B.队列

C.链表

D.树

7.在堆排序算法中,堆调整的时间复杂度是()。

A.O(1)

B.O(logn)

C.O(n)

D.O(nlogn)

8.下列关于哈希表的描述中,哪个是正确的()。

A.哈希表的时间复杂度总是O(1)

B

文档评论(0)

1亿VIP精品文档

相关文档